Barbecue Skewers
Barbecue skewers are essential tools for outdoor grilling and barbecue enthusiasts. They are a type of barbecue utensil used for skewering and grilling various types of food, such as meat, vegetables, seafood, and even fruit. These skewers are an integral part of the grilling experience and can enhance the flavor and presentation of your grilled dishes. Here are some key points about barbecue skewers:
Materials: Barbecue skewers are typically made from various materials, including stainless steel, bamboo, and metal. Stainless steel skewers are durable, reusable, and easy to clean, making them a popular choice among grillers.Bamboo skewers are disposable and offer a natural, rustic look but may require soaking in water before grilling to prevent burning.
Types: There are different types of skewers available, such as flat, round, or double-pronged skewers. The choice of skewer type depends on the specific dishes you plan to grill.
Size: Skewer size can vary, from short cocktail skewers for bite-sized appetizers to longer skewers for kebabs and larger pieces of food. Choose the appropriate size based on your grilling needs.
Preparation: Before using skewers, it's important to prepare them properly. If you're using bamboo skewers, soak them in water for about 30 minutes to prevent them from burning on the grill. This step is not necessary for stainless steel skewers.
Food Skewering: Skewering food is an art form. You can alternate pieces of meat, vegetables, and other ingredients to create visually appealing and flavorful skewers. Marinades and seasonings can be applied to enhance the taste.
Grilling: Once the skewers are prepared, they are placed on the grill. It's essential to rotate the skewers to ensure even cooking and prevent burning. The cooking time varies depending on the type and size of food on the skewer.
Presentation: Skewers offer an attractive way to serve grilled food. You can arrange them on a platter or serve them directly on the skewer for a rustic presentation.
Cleaning: Stainless steel skewers are easy to clean as they can be washed and reused. Bamboo skewers are typically disposable and should be discarded after use.
Variations: There are specialized skewers designed for specific dishes, such as shish kebabs, satay, and even dessert skewers for items like marshmallows and fruit.
Accessories: Some barbecue skewer sets come with accessories like skewer racks or stands that make it easier to grill multiple skewers at once.
